I had to rebuild my computer due to flaky hard drives.
I was able to move my library disk intact to the new system.
- I’ve tried to follow the steps listed here. -
- I’ve installed PlexMediaServer-1.32.6.7468-07e0d4a7e-x86_64
- I signed in when asked
- I signed out and exited PMS by right-clicking the system tray icon and picking exit
- I copied data from “%LOCALAPPDATA%\Plex Media Server” (C:\users\OLDUSERNAME\appdata\local\Plex Media Server") on the old boot drive to “%LOCALAPPDATA%\Plex Media Server” (C:\users\NEWUSERNAME\appdata\local\Plex Media Server") on the new computer.
- I was unable to access the registry from the old build
- I rebooted the computer
- I wait for PMS to show in the system tray
- I right-click and choose to Open Plex
- It asks me to sign in, I do
- It says “Initializing Plex Media Server…”
- Eventually this changes to “Something went wrong. Make sure the server is available and try again.”
- If I try to Open the Plex Web App, it opens as me but doesn’t think I have media.
- When I click the + next to Your Media, it acts like it doesn’t see my media server.
HOW DO I REGAIN ACCESS TO MY PLEX MEDIA LIBRARY?
